What to know about 9/11 Memorial & Museum

Nestled at the heart of the World Trade Center in New York City, the 9/11 Memorial & Museum stands as a beacon of reflection, remembrance, and resilience. This sacred site invites visitors from around the globe to honor the memory of the 2,983 lives lost during the tragic events of September 11, 2001, and the February 26, 1993, World Trade Center bombing. As you step into this poignant destination, you are welcomed into a space where architecture, archaeology, and history converge to offer a profound and moving experience. Through powerful narratives, authentic artifacts, and personal stories of loss, recovery, and hope, the museum provides an unforgettable encounter with these pivotal moments in history. Beyond its exhibitions, the 9/11 Memorial & Museum celebrates the courage and compassion that emerged in the aftermath, offering educational programs that explore the impact of terrorism and the enduring value of human dignity. Whether you're a history enthusiast or a traveler seeking a deeper understanding of these events, a visit to the 9/11 Memorial & Museum promises a journey of reflection and inspiration.
180 Greenwich St, New York, NY 10007, United States

Remarkable Landmarks and Must-Visit Sights

9/11 Memorial

Step into a place of profound reflection and remembrance at the 9/11 Memorial. Open until 8 p.m., this serene space invites you to honor the lives lost by placing flowers or flags on the bronze parapets, each inscribed with the names of the victims. As you walk through this tranquil setting, you'll find a moment of peace amidst the bustling city, offering a heartfelt tribute to those who were taken too soon.

9/11 Museum

Embark on a journey through history at the 9/11 Museum, open until 7 p.m. This immersive experience brings the story of September 11th to life through powerful media, narratives, and a collection of monumental artifacts, including the iconic FDNY Ladder 3. As you explore, you'll gain a deeper understanding of the day's events and their lasting impact on the world, making it a must-visit for anyone seeking to connect with this pivotal moment in history.

Memorial Plaza

Discover a place of beauty and remembrance at the Memorial Plaza, where nature and history intertwine. This serene public space, adorned with swamp white oaks, features two stunning reflecting pools with cascading waterfalls set in the footprints of the Twin Towers. As you wander through, take a moment to visit the Memorial Glade, honoring the brave rescue and recovery workers, and the resilient Survivor Tree, a symbol of hope and renewal. It's a peaceful oasis that invites reflection and connection.

Cultural and Historical Significance

The 9/11 Memorial & Museum is a profound educational resource that deepens our understanding of the events of September 11 and their lasting impact. It offers specialized programs for students, educators, families, and visitors, fostering a place of remembrance and learning. This site honors the lives lost and celebrates the heroes who rose in the face of tragedy, showcasing the resilience and strength of the human spirit. It also highlights the global repercussions of the attacks and the collective response of compassion and resilience, making it a site of immense historical and cultural importance.
